Society Creates Tartan Recognizing Municipality Of Barrington

The Municipality of Barrington is close to getting its own tartan.

A pair of staff members at the Cape Sable Historical Society created the cloth.

There are seven different colors that recognize fishermen, lighthouses, lumberjacks and beaches.

Warden Eddie Nickerson says it’s a great initiative.

“It’s a great idea that was supported whole-heartedly by council and it’s something where we can be identified by a tartan now.”

Council is expected to give final approval next week.

It would be called the ‘Municipality of Barrington Tartan.’
